Declaratory Ruling Declaratory ruling proceedings may be initiated either upon request or by the Utilities Board itself. DRUs offer the Board's interpretation of the rules in their application to a particular hypothetical circumstance. Electric Franchise A franchise is the authorization by the Utilities Board for the construction, erection, maintenance, and operation of an electric transmission line under Iowa Code chapter 478. The granting of a franchise requires a finding by the Board that the project is necessary to serve a public use, represents a reasonable relationship to an overall plan of transmitting electricity in the public interest, and follows an acceptable route.
